Nikolaj “niko” Kristensen has officially joined the Rogue CS:GO squad according to the team’s official twitter account. Niko replaces fellow Dane Jesper “TENZKI” Plougmann on the squad. The move comes just weeks after Rogue failed to qualify for the IEM Katowice Major Qualifiers.
Previously, niko helped his former team, Optic Gaming, place second at cs_summit 3 in November and fourth at StarSeries & i-League Season 6. Rogue, for its part, has been trying to replace Ricardo “Rickeh” Mulholland since December 29th, using TENZKI as a stand-in until the niko signing.

Niko’s first maps with Rogue Gaming will be played this weekend at the IEM Sydney North American Open Qualifier. After this new signing, the Rogue lineup is as follows:
Nikolaj “niko” Kristensen
Hunter “SicK” Mims
Daniel “vice” Kim
Mathias “MSL” Lauridsen
Spencer “Hiko” Martin
